Description

The classic dramatization of sir thomas more’S historic conflict with henry viiia compelling portrait of a courageous man who died for his convictions.Sir thomas morethe brilliant nobleman, lawyer, humanist, author of such works as utopiawas a long-Time friend and favorite of henry viii, ascending to the position of lord chancellor in 1529. Yet he was also a staunch catholic, and when henry broke with the church in 1531 after the pope had refused to grant him a divorce from catherine of aragon, more resigned the chancellorship. In 1534, parliament passed a bill requiring all subjects to take an oath acknowledging the supremacy of england’S king over all foreign sovereignsincluding the pope. More refused, was imprisoned, and finally was executed in 1535.
